To provide a nonwoven fabric which becomes suitably bulky when water is absorbed.SOLUTION: A nonwoven fabric contains a thermally fusible fiber and a water-absorbing shrinkable fiber, and bonding between the fibers is made by the fusion force of the thermally fusible fiber. The nonwoven fabric has a first fiber layer containing the water-absorbing shrinkable fiber and a second fiber layer containing no water-absorbing shrinkable fiber, which is laminated on the first fiber layer. The water-absorbing shrinkable fiber has a fiber length of 20 to 100 mm, and is contained in an amount of 20 mass% or more relative to the total mass of the nonwoven fabric.
